Talk

StranglerApplication Pattern, a legacy frontend use case

PUBBLICATO IL 11/05/2018 DA

Francesco

Development

SKILL
Agile development
IN SINTESI

Argomento principale del talk presentato al JsDay2018 è il “Codice Legacy” e come questo argomento è stato affrontato nel progetto del nostro cliente Giuffrè Francis Lefebvre. Il pattern che abbiamo adottato è StranglerApplication: una nuova applicazione “iniettata” dentro l’originale che nel tempo “mangia” la vecchia applicazione.

Questo approccio permette un miglioramento evolutivo del software senza dover riscrivere tutto, permettendo quindi ai team di non dover fermare lo sviluppo. Nel caso particolare di Giuffrè, abbiamo deciso di passare dalla nostra originale applicazione AngularJS ad un’applicazione Frameworkless per assicurare al cliente la maggior longevità possibile alla loro base di codice.

Nella parte finale del talk si parla di come i ragionamenti fatti su questo progetto abbiano aperto la strada alla creazione del Frameworkless Movement.

Qui di seguito trovi le slide e la registrazione, mentre il repo con il codice è su GitHub.

<

figure>

Flowing nasce il 19.02.2019 da ideato e extrategy, ecco perché nelle slide e nel video trovi uno di questi brand! Scopri di più sul nostro speciale percorso di co-creazione di Flowing.


Contatta i nostri esperti

per parlare di come possiamo aiutare te e la tua azienda ad evolvere

Contattaci